Oil pressure warning light
If the Oil pressure warning light
stays on after starting or illuminates
during a journey, stop immediately,
switch off the engine and check the
engine oil level.
Top up straight away if the level is
low.
Do not resume the journey
if the oil level is correct,
there may be a problem with the
engine lubrication system and
engine damage may occur. Have
the engine checked by an expert.
Ford authorized repairers are
recommended.
Engine oil filler cap
The oil filler cap is a twist-on fit
design. To open, turn the cap
anti-clockwise. Do not open the cap
while the engine is running.
Do not use oil additives or
other engine treatments.
They are unnecessary and could,
under certain conditions, lead to
engine damage which is not
covered by Ford Warranty.
To close, turn the cap clockwise
until a strong resistance is felt.
Make sure the cap is
twisted on tightly.
Undertightening could allow oil to
leak out.
